Four rods of equal length L are joined by four pins A,B,C & D as shown in the figure. Rods are free to rotated about pins. Pin A is given velocity v_(0) and pin C is given 3v_(0) as shown The angular velocity of rod BC is

Answer»

`(2v_(0))/(L)`
`(2v_(0))/(L) SIN theta`
`(2v_(0))/(L sin theta)`
`(2v_(0))/(L)costheta`

SOLUTION :`v sin theta+2v_(0) cos theta=4v_(0) cos theta`
`rArr v=2v_(0) cot theta`
`therefore v_(B)=2v_(0) cosec theta`

`omega=(2v_(0)sin theta+v cos theta)/(L)=(2v_(0))/(L sin theta)`
